引言
在现代软件开发中,版本控制系统的使用已经成为了必不可少的环节。而GitHub作为一种流行的在线版本控制平台,与多种开发工具和IDE(集成开发环境)紧密集成。本文将详细介绍如何使用GitHub IDEA,让您能够更高效地管理代码和项目。
GitHub IDEA简介
GitHub IDEA 是 JetBrains 出品的集成开发环境,旨在提供强大的功能以支持多种编程语言的开发。它与GitHub无缝集成,能够直接在IDE中执行Git操作,方便开发者进行代码管理和协作。
1. 安装GitHub IDEA
1.1 系统要求
- 操作系统: Windows, macOS, 或 Linux
- 内存: 至少 2 GB RAM(推荐 8 GB 或以上)
- 硬盘空间: 至少 1 GB 的可用空间
1.2 安装步骤
- 访问 JetBrains官网。
- 点击“Download”按钮,选择适合您操作系统的版本。
- 下载完成后,运行安装程序并按照提示完成安装。
2. 配置GitHub IDEA
2.1 首次启动配置
- 启动GitHub IDEA,选择初始配置。
- 登录到您的GitHub账户,您可以通过提供账户名和密码或使用Token方式登录。
2.2 配置Git
- 打开 File > Settings(或 IDEA > Preferences),然后导航到Version Control > Git。
- 输入您本地Git的路径,通常为
/usr/bin/git
或C:\Program Files\Git\bin\git.exe
。 - 点击“Test”按钮确保配置正确。
3. 使用GitHub IDEA的功能
3.1 创建新项目
- 选择 File > New Project。
- 选择项目类型(Java, Kotlin, Python等),然后填写项目名称和路径。
3.2 导入已有项目
- 选择 File > New > Project from Version Control。
- 输入GitHub项目的URL,然后选择保存路径,点击“Clone”。
3.3 常用Git操作
- 提交代码: 选择版本控制选项,然后点击“Commit”提交更改。
- 拉取和推送: 使用右上角的“VCS”菜单进行拉取和推送操作。
- 查看版本历史: 选择“Git > Show History”,可查看项目的所有提交记录。
3.4 使用分支
- 创建新分支: 选择 Git > Branches > New Branch。
- 切换分支: 使用Git > Branches菜单选择要切换的分支。
- 合并分支: 选择目标分支后,点击“Merge”。
4. 常见问题解答 (FAQ)
4.1 如何在GitHub IDEA中解决冲突?
在GitHub IDEA中,如果遇到代码冲突,您可以通过以下步骤解决:
- 当您执行“Pull”操作后,IDEA会提示您存在冲突。
- 选择“Resolve”后,IDEA将打开一个冲突解决界面。
- 在界面中,您可以选择保留当前版本、远程版本或手动合并代码。
4.2 如何在IDEA中查看代码的修改历史?
您可以通过以下步骤查看代码的修改历史:
- 选择 Version Control 窗口,找到您感兴趣的文件。
- 右键点击文件,选择“Show History”。
- 在弹出的窗口中,您可以查看该文件的所有修改记录。
4.3 如何配置代理以便使用GitHub?
- 在Settings窗口中,导航至 Appearance & Behavior > System Settings > HTTP Proxy。
- 选择合适的代理类型并填写代理服务器地址及端口。
- 确认后,点击“Apply”保存设置。
结论
使用GitHub IDEA进行开发,能极大提高代码管理的效率。通过上述步骤,您可以轻松安装、配置及使用该IDE,充分发挥其强大功能。希望本文对您有所帮助,让您的开发工作更加顺畅!
正文完